Introduction
In recent years we’ve witnessed a major shift: the battle between browsers is no longer just about speed, compatibility, or extensions. It now becomes intelligent thanks to the integration of Artificial Intelligence.
The latest frontier is the AI-powered browser, which promises to fundamentally transform the browsing user experience.
Terms like AI browser, browser war 2025, browser AI features, and agentic browsing are now increasingly relevant. Traditionally, the browser war meant Chrome vs Firefox vs Edge. Today it is turning into a fight for intelligent action, web workflow automation, and control of user data.
Key takeaway
The browser is shifting from a container to an active assistant: not just displaying pages, but interpreting, summarizing, and taking actions.

Why this war started
Browser dominance and the search market
Google Chrome still holds a dominant market share: the browser is the front door to the web and, by extension, to advertising ecosystems, data collection, and search. When browsers become a place where AI can act, not just a passive container, the stakes rise dramatically.
AI as a renewal lever
Integrating language models, intelligent agents, and assistants into the browser means the user is no longer just a navigator, but an AI collaborator. Summarizing web pages, completing forms, and automating browsing tasks are the key pillars of this new paradigm.
Regulatory and competitive pressure
Antitrust authorities are watching closely: tying a search engine to a browser can create barriers to entry. At the same time, startups and new entrants see AI browsers as a break-point to gain market share.
Key players
Comet by Perplexity AI
Comet is a Chromium-based browser launched by Perplexity, integrating intelligent agents, contextual search, and automation of online tasks. It matters because it is among the first AI-native browsers designed by a startup to challenge established giants.
Strengths:
- understanding web content;
- responding in context;
- executing actions.
ChatGPT Atlas by OpenAI
Launched in 2025, ChatGPT Atlas is a browser integrated with the ChatGPT ecosystem, positioned not only as a browsing tool, but as an active assistant.
Strengths:
- assistant sidebar integration;
- agent mode that can perform actions for subscribers;
- contextual browsing memory.
The old guard: Google Chrome and competitors
Chrome remains the leader, but it must respond to the rise of AI-centric browsers. Microsoft Edge and others are already adding AI features, showing that the battle is not only about new entrants, but also about how existing browsers evolve.
What changes for users
Automation and intelligent agents
AI browsers promise to automate tasks like form filling, price comparisons, article summaries, and data extraction. The browser moves from a passive tool to an active assistant.
More contextual and personalized browsing
Browsing memory, user context, and analysis of open pages become central. The goal is to remember what you were doing and proactively suggest next steps.
New UX models and interfaces
The interface changes: less address bar, more conversational interaction, with deeper integration between search, chat, and action.
Privacy and security implications
With AI operating inside the browser, new risks emerge: handling sensitive data, new vulnerabilities, and an innovation race that may skip security steps.
Risks, criticism, and open questions
Bringing AI into browsers often depends on collecting and processing user data such as history, visited content, and interactions, raising concerns around privacy and profiling. Automated browsing agents may also become targets for attacks, for example through manipulated pages.
A web dominated by answer engines could reduce traffic to traditional websites, reshaping how information is distributed.
Finally, concentrated control of data by a few players raises concerns about monopoly power, transparency, and competition in the new digital ecosystem.
Attention
An AI browser is not just another browser with a smarter search box. It can become an intelligent endpoint with access to pages, credentials, documents, workflows, and sensitive information. That changes the risk profile.
Future scenarios
Best case
AI integration delivers truly intelligent browsing, understanding user tasks, proposing solutions, and acting securely while respecting privacy.
Most realistic scenario
A long transition phase where traditional and AI-centric browsers coexist, and only a portion of users fully adopt the new technologies.
Worst case
Privacy, security, and power concentration concerns trigger stricter regulation, or accelerate the rise of decentralized, privacy-first browsers.
In every scenario, the impact on IT professionals, developers, and marketers will be significant: strategies for visibility will change, web apps must remain secure and accessible, and compliance requirements like GDPR and NIS2 will matter even more.
Practical guide for users and businesses
What to consider when choosing an AI browser
- Privacy: look for clear policies, for example no training on your data without consent.
- Features: memory, agents, task automation, and extension compatibility.
- Platforms: desktop, mobile, and sync options.
- Maturity: beta vs stable, community, and support.
For businesses and IT teams
- Reassess risk: the browser becomes an intelligent endpoint with potentially massive data access.
- Define security policies: updates, sandboxing, credential management, and agent controls.
- Governance: measure impact on workflows and productivity, with rules and monitoring.
- Training: users shift from browsing to interacting with an agent.
Tips for general users
- Test an AI browser as a secondary browser before switching fully.
- Use AI features, but monitor permissions and what you authorize.
- Manage privacy: history, stored data, and backups.
- Stay updated: new versions bring new features and new risks.
In practice
For companies, browser choice is becoming less of a personal preference and more of an IT governance topic. The browser is now part of productivity, security, data management, and compliance.

Frequently asked questions
What is an AI browser?
An AI browser is a browser that integrates artificial intelligence features such as page summarization, contextual search, task automation, intelligent agents, and conversational interaction.
Why are AI browsers important for businesses?
Because they can improve productivity and automate browsing tasks, but they also introduce new risks related to privacy, data access, credentials, governance, and security policies.
Should a company allow employees to use AI browsers freely?
Not without clear rules. Companies should define policies for approved browsers, data handling, permissions, agent actions, updates, and user training.
Will AI browsers replace traditional browsers?
Not immediately. A more realistic scenario is a transition period where traditional browsers and AI-centric browsers coexist, with adoption depending on trust, security, usability, and business policies.
